Turkish bath benefits: cleansing, exfoliation, and social ritual
Turkish bath benefits go beyond heat; the hammam ritual centers on cleansing, exfoliation, and a generous rinse. A typical hammam experience blends warmth, damp air, and a textured scrub with a kese mitt, which supports skin renewal and a feeling of lightness. The Turkish bath benefits are not only physical but also experiential, tying cleansing to a tactile, mindful ritual.
Beyond the physical effects, the Turkish bath experience often carries a social dimension—families or friends share space, exchange conversation, and follow a shared routine. This sociable aspect contributes to stress relief and a sense of community, making hammam rituals about connection as much as cleansing.
Steam room benefits: hydration, respiration, and recovery
Steam room benefits include hydrating the skin and soothing the airways thanks to nearly 100% humidity and warm, enveloping heat. The moist environment helps loosen mucus, support nasal drainage, and promote sweating without the intensity of dry heat. This environment makes the steam room a gentle ally for daily relaxation and post-exercise cooldown.
For athletes and anyone needing a quiet cooldown, the steam room supports muscle relaxation and breathing ease in a calm setting. The focus is less on cleansing and more on the physiological effects of moist heat and controlled humidity, aligning with a restorative wellness routine rather than a spa ritual.
Hammam rituals and Turkish bath experience: what to expect
In a Turkish bath experience, expect a ritualized sequence: a warm room to open pores, a thorough exfoliation, and a relaxing foam rinse that leaves skin smooth. The Turkish bath experience often includes guidance from staff and a pace that lets heat, water, and touch work together for renewal. Planning ahead can help you acclimate to the humidity and the social etiquette of the space.
While hammam rituals are communal in many cultures, you can also enjoy a personal routine. The Hammam vs steam room distinction emerges in the structure and social dynamic: hammams emphasize ritual flow and conversation, whereas steam room sessions lean toward solitude and personal relaxation. Communicate your preferences to staff to tailor the experience to your comfort level.
Sauna vs steam room and the heat modality choice
Sauna vs steam room contrasts are rooted in heat modality: dry, high-temperature air in a sauna versus moist, enveloping heat in a steam room. Dry heat can feel more intense and may be ideal for a quick sweat, while humid heat supports breathing comfort and skin hydration. Understanding these differences helps you pick the best option for your tolerance and schedule.
Choosing between these options depends on goals and health considerations. If you prioritize respiratory comfort and a calming atmosphere, the steam room may be preferable; if you enjoy dry heat and stronger sweating, the sauna could suit you. Always consider hydration, duration, and any medical guidance when tailoring your heat experience.
